package deploy import ( "os" "strings" "git.solsynth.dev/goatworks/turbine/pkg/launchpad/config" "github.com/rs/zerolog/log" "gopkg.in/yaml.v3" ) // --- Docker Compose Structures for YAML Marshalling --- type ComposeFile struct { Version string `yaml:"version"` Services map[string]ComposeService `yaml:"services"` Networks map[string]interface{} `yaml:"networks,omitempty"` } type ComposeService struct { Image string `yaml:"image,omitempty"` Build *ComposeBuild `yaml:"build,omitempty"` Command interface{} `yaml:"command,omitempty"` Ports []string `yaml:"ports,omitempty"` Expose []string `yaml:"expose,omitempty"` Environment map[string]string `yaml:"environment,omitempty"` Volumes []string `yaml:"volumes,omitempty"` DependsOn map[string]config.Dependency `yaml:"depends_on,omitempty"` Networks []string `yaml:"networks,omitempty"` Healthcheck *config.Healthcheck `yaml:"healthcheck,omitempty"` } type ComposeBuild struct { Context string `yaml:"context,omitempty"` Dockerfile string `yaml:"dockerfile,omitempty"` } // GenerateDockerCompose creates a docker-compose.yml file from the launchpad config. func GenerateDockerCompose(cfg config.LaunchpadConfig) { compose := ComposeFile{ Version: "3.8", Services: make(map[string]ComposeService), Networks: cfg.Networks, } for _, s := range cfg.Services { subst := func(val string) string { return os.ExpandEnv(val) } composeService := ComposeService{ Image: subst(s.Prod.Image), Command: s.Prod.Command, Ports: s.Prod.Ports, Expose: s.Prod.Expose, Volumes: s.Prod.Volumes, DependsOn: s.Prod.DependsOn, Networks: s.Prod.Networks, } // Add healthcheck if defined if len(s.Prod.Healthcheck.Test) > 0 { composeService.Healthcheck = &s.Prod.Healthcheck } if s.Prod.Dockerfile != "" { context := "." if s.Prod.BuildContext != "" { context = s.Prod.BuildContext } composeService.Build = &ComposeBuild{ Context: context, Dockerfile: s.Prod.Dockerfile, } } if len(s.Prod.Environment) > 0 { envMap := make(map[string]string) for _, env := range s.Prod.Environment { parts := strings.SplitN(subst(env), "=", 2) if len(parts) == 2 { envMap[parts[0]] = parts[1] } } composeService.Environment = envMap } compose.Services[s.Name] = composeService } yamlData, err := yaml.Marshal(&compose) if err != nil { log.Fatal().Err(err).Msg("Failed to generate YAML for docker-compose") } outFile := "docker-compose.yml" if err := os.WriteFile(outFile, yamlData, 0o644); err != nil { log.Fatal().Err(err).Msgf("Failed to write %s", outFile) } log.Info().Msgf("Successfully generated %s", outFile) }
